NOVEMBER NEWSLETTER

                            

Dear Parents:

 

It’s hard to believe that the Holiday season is right around the corner.  We have been very busy this month.

 

Please keep checking our website – www.mascenic.org.  New items and photos are always being added.

 

Parent/Teacher conferences are November 10th.  This is a very busy day for the teachers.  If you cannot make your appointment time, please call your teacher and let her know ASAP.

 

Mrs. Leel is willing to coordinate the Destination Imagination program at Appleton.  For the program to run it needs Team Managers.  If you are interested in volunteering, there will be an informational meeting on November 12th in the Appleton cafeteria at 4:00 p.m.

 

Kindergarten Update:  The completed Grant Proposal will be submitted to the State after School Board approval at Monday night’s School Board meeting.  We are that much closer to having Kindergarten!  YEA!

 

The New Hampshire State Fire Marshall’s Office has sent us some new orders after their recent inspection of both Central and Appleton Elementary Schools.  We can no longer hang student artwork, posters, etc. in the hallways.  The classroom cannot have more than 20% of wall space covered with flammable material and nothing can hang from the ceiling or lights.

 

On Tuesday, November 11, I will be changing my schedule.  I will start my day at Appleton and move to Central at noon.
